Fundamentally research we have carried out and continue to carry out is clearly showing that in the distribution networks energy is not proportional to data traffic. 

This is a common misunderstanding. It leads to digital media companies being quite wed to the idea that saving data saves the planet.

We are seeing no evidence that not sending data reduces energy consumption. We have been measuring events like the world cup streaming online and more, and network energy is not related to traffic, it is related to the peak provisioned capacity of the network. Much looks to be similar in cloud.

It might be worth exploring that theme and thinking about it in terms of some of the guidelines you have been publishing..
